Conveyor dishwasher and method for operating a conveyor dishwasher
A conveyor dishwasher (1) has at least one wash zone (11, 12) in which wash liquid is sprayed onto the washware, at least one final rinse zone (14) in which final rinse liquid is sprayed onto the washware and a waste air system (20) for discharging waste air from the conveyor dishwasher (1). To save energy and maintain hygiene performance, a waste water heat recovery system (25) is provided for transferring at least a portion of the thermal energy in the waste water from the conveyor dishwasher (1) as useful heat to the final rinse liquid and a waste air heat recovery system is further provided for transferring at least a portion of the thermal energy in the waste air which is discharged or is to be discharged from the conveyor dishwasher (1) as useful heat to at least the final rinse.
SUSPENSION SYSTEM FOR A FLUID CIRCULATION ASSEMBLY OF A DISHWASHER APPLIANCE
A dishwasher appliance includes a tub that defines a wash chamber for receipt of articles for washing. A sump is positioned at a bottom of the wash chamber for receiving fluid from the wash chamber. A fluid circulation assembly is at least partially disposed within the sump. The fluid circulation assembly is mounted in the sump with a resilient mounting post, whereby the fluid circulation assembly is vibrationally isolated from the sump.
REDUCED SOUND WITH A ROTATING FILTER FOR A DISHWASHER
A dishwasher with a tub at least partially defining a washing chamber, a liquid spraying system, a liquid recirculation system defining a recirculation flow path, and a liquid filtering system. The liquid filtering system includes a rotating filter disposed in the recirculation flow path to filter the liquid and a flow diverter wherein liquid passing through a gap between the flow diverter and the rotating filter applies a greater shear force on the surface than liquid in an absence of the flow diverter.

USE OF RECYCLED WASH AND RINSE WATER FOR THE PRE-RINSE OPERATION OF DISHES
A dishwashing machine is used for pre-rinse operation of soiled dishes. A cavity is configured and arranged to contain the soiled dishes. A nozzle is proximate the cavity and is in fluid communication with the cavity. An accumulator pan accumulates wash and rinse water including cleaning chemicals used in a previous cycle of the dishwashing machine. A fluid passageway interconnects the nozzle and the accumulator pan. A pump directs the accumulated wash and rinse water from the accumulator pan to the nozzle via the fluid passageway for pre-rinse operation of the soiled dishes in the cavity, and the nozzle directs the accumulated wash and rinse water into the cavity with the soiled dishes to assist in removing soil from the soiled dishes prior to a wash cycle of the dishwashing machine. The wash cycle utilizes fresh wash water.
Fluid circulation assembly for a dishwasher appliance
A dishwasher appliance includes a wash tub defining a wash chamber, a sump housing defining a sump for collecting wash fluid, the sump housing defining a drain basin, and a fluid circulation assembly positioned within the sump. The fluid circulation assembly includes a drain cover seated within the drain basin, a wash pump assembly seated on top of the drain cover, a filter cleaning manifold positioned over the wash pump assembly, and a plurality of mechanical fasteners that pass through filter cleaning manifold and into the sump housing to attach the filter cleaning manifold to the sump housing and to secure the wash pump assembly and the filter cleaning manifold within the sump.
